Alida Houghton Obituary

Houghton, Alida

Alida Houghton, 89, of Schenectady, NY, passed away on Monday, January 30, 2012, at Ellis Hospital. She was the daughter of the late, Grant and Mary Alida Carley. She was born in 1922 and raised in Maine, NY. She was a great mother-in-law, mother, grand mother and great great grandmother. Alida enjoyed quilting, reading, great storytelling and traveling all over the country. She had worked for GE and retired from IBM. She was the most beautiful person to everyone that knew her. She loved spending time with family and especially with all of her grandchildren and great grandchildren. She was survived by her son, Lauren (Pat) Houghton, Lisle, NY, two dauthers, Linda Houghton, Phillisburg, NJ, Alice Griffin Whitmore, Johnson City, NY; one sister, Penny Hust, Glen Aubrey, NY; 15 grandchildren; 22 great grandchildren; nine great great grandchildren; and three on the way; many aunts, uncles, nieces, nephews and cousins. She was predeceased by her parents, Grant (Mary Alida) Carley; her sister, Verna; son, Philip; and grandson, Noah. Alida lived a great life with her caregivers, Robin and Will Aponte before her passing. There will be a celebrating of her at the Town of Binghamton Community Center, 1905 Coleman Rd, Binghamton, NY, Saturday, February 4, 2012 at 2:00PM. Burial will be in the Spring at the Maine Cemetery at the families convenience. She will always be in the hearts of all family members, friends and loved ones.
